1965 Pilot Line Corvette Valued at $900,000 to 1.2 Million! What makes this special 1965 Pilot Line Corvette so unique? It has the perfect blend of performance, history, and pedigree. This 1965 Corvette Sting Ray “Pilot Line” Convertible, Serial No. 003, is the first non-competition Corvette ever to receive a Mark IV big-block engine and the first with 427 power. It is the first 1965 Corvette Convertible and was a GM Styling Exercise Corvette. Mecum estimates this 1965 Corvette will fetch $900,000 - 1.2 million when it crosses the auction block on May 21, 2022, in Indianapolis, Indiana.
